What is the main purpose of performing calibrations on testing equipment?

The primary purpose of performing calibrations on testing equipment is to ensure accurate test results. Calibration is a process that involves comparing the measurements of an instrument or device against a known standard to confirm that it functions correctly and provides reliable measurements. This is critical in non-destructive testing (NDT) and other measurement-dependent fields where the precision and accuracy of results can greatly impact safety, compliance, and quality assurance. Accurate test results are vital to determining material properties, detecting flaws, and making informed decisions based on those findings.

While verifying operational efficiency and enhancing equipment design are important aspects of equipment management, they do not directly address the crucial need for accuracy in measurements that calibration fulfills. Reducing equipment maintenance is more related to operational upkeep rather than the purpose of calibration itself. Therefore, ensuring that the test results are accurate is the primary reason for calibrating testing equipment.
